文档章节

PHP中常见的函数功能说明

IamOkay
 IamOkay
发布于 2014/11/05 22:47
字数 174
阅读 46
收藏 1
1.rand是官方函数,mt_rand的是非官方的,mt_rand的效率和速度比rand要高的多

2.substr与mb_substr关系,strlen与mb_strlen:substr是按照字符来截取字符串的,
mb_substr是按照字符编码来截取的,同理strlen与mb_strlen功能类似。

3.mb_convert_encoding用来转换字符编码。

4.get_included_files,返回被 include 和 require 文件名的 array

5.include,require,include_once,require_once。include引入的文件非必要文件,require引入的是必要文件,
 include有返回值,而require没有;include_once和require_once值允许引入一次。


/**本博客未完成,将会定期更新**/



© 著作权归作者所有

共有 人打赏支持
IamOkay
粉丝 190
博文 461
码字总数 373670
作品 0
海淀
程序员
私信 提问
Web攻防系列教程之浅析PHP命令注入攻击

摘要:PHP命令注入攻击漏洞是PHP应用程序中常见的脚本漏洞之一,国内著名的Web应用程序Discuz!、DedeCMS等都曾经存在过该类型漏洞。本文描述了常见的PHP命令注入攻击漏洞存在形式和利用方法,...

伽罗kapple
2015/11/28
58
0
huangjacky/Security-CI

#Security-CI 作者: huangjacky QQ: 4462676 Email: huangjacky@163.com 结合日常工作将一些安全特性注入到CodeIgniter框架中,从而使开发更加安全和易用. 代办 1. 完善过滤函数 check_helper...

huangjacky
2015/04/16
0
0
关于PHP的漏洞以及如何防止PHP漏洞?

漏洞无非这么几类,XSS、sql注入、命令执行、上传漏洞、本地包含、远程包含、权限绕过、信息泄露、cookie伪造、CSRF(跨站请求)等。这些漏洞不仅仅是针对PHP语言的,本文只是简单介绍PHP如何有...

mckee
2013/07/01
0
1
PHP中函数的运行机制与实现原理

PHP中函数的运行机制与实现原理 在任何语言中,函数都是最基本的组成单元。对于php的函数,它具有哪些特点?函数调用是怎么实现的?php函数的性能如何,有什么使用建议?本文将从原理出发进行...

雾渺
2012/05/02
0
0
php函数的实现原理及性能分析

前言 在任何语言中,函数都是最基本的技术单元之一。对于php的函数,它具有哪些特点?函数调用是怎么实现?php函数的性能如何,有什么使用建议?本文将从原理出发进行分析结合实际的性能测试...

菜到没谱
2013/10/11
0
5

没有更多内容

加载失败,请刷新页面

加载更多

iOS 官方文档

https://developer.apple.com/library/prerelease/content/navigation/#section=Platforms&topic=iOS...

walking_yxf
8分钟前
1
0
使用Mycat实现MySQL数据库的读写分离

前提准备 1.一台CentOS机器 2.Mycat安装包 (http://www.mycat.io/) 安装使用 1.解压Mycat的安装包到/user/local/下 2.设置mycat的环境变量 vi /etc/profile 3.使配置文件立即生效 source /...

吴伟祥
9分钟前
1
0
Aries数据库事务Recovery算法

背景知识 本文是一篇关于(分布式)数据库的文章,在开始阐述Aries是什么之前,需要先交代几个常识性的概念,这些概念对后文引出Aries显得尤为重要。 数据库体系结构 图1大致描述了一个(分布...

黑客画家
12分钟前
1
0
Rxjava Backpressure 32

原文:https://github.com/Froussios/Intro-To-RxJava/blob/master/Part 4 - Concurrency/4. Backpressure.md Rx将事件从管道的一端引导到另一端,在每一端发生的行动可能非常不同。当生产者...

woshixin
13分钟前
1
0
IDEA-Create Git Repository

1、概述 idea 开发完毕的项目没有及时的关联gitlab,如果整体项目关联gitlab。 2、干 2.1 gitlab 创建项目 2.2 idea 1、IDEA 点击 -> VCS -> import into version control -> create git re......

来来来来来
16分钟前
0
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部